跳到主要内容
Didit 融资 750 万美元,打造身份与欺诈基础设施
Didit
返回博客
博客 · 2026年3月7日

Didit SDK:优化移动应用的包大小与加载时间 (ZH)

了解 Didit 的 SDK 如何实现最小化包大小和快速加载时间,这对于卓越的移动应用性能至关重要。探索模块化设计、高效数据处理以及我们的人工智能原生方法如何确保流畅体验。.

作者:Didit更新于
didit-sdks-optimizing-bundle-size-and-load-times-for-mobile-apps.png

轻量级集成Didit 的 SDK 设计注重最小化包大小,确保您的移动应用保持精简并实现最佳性能,避免不必要的臃肿。

快速性能高效的数据处理和优化的代码有助于实现快速加载,从安装那一刻起就提供无缝且无挫的用户体验。

模块化架构我们以开发者为中心的方法允许您仅集成必要的身份验证组件,防止功能蔓延并保持较小的占用空间。

AI原生效率Didit 利用 AI 提供强大的身份验证、活体检测和人脸匹配功能,具有固有的效率,确保在提升高级安全性的同时不牺牲性能。

移动应用性能的关键性

在当今快节奏的数字世界中,移动应用性能至关重要。用户期望应用程序响应迅速、加载快速并消耗最少的资源。臃肿的应用包或缓慢的加载时间可能导致高放弃率、糟糕的用户评价,并最终对您的品牌声誉产生负面影响。对于需要身份验证的应用程序来说尤其如此,在这些应用程序中,流畅、不间断的用户旅程对于转化和信任至关重要。在集成第三方 SDK 时,评估它们对应用程序整体大小和速度的影响至关重要。一个单独表现良好的 SDK 在与现有代码库结合时可能会引入显著的开销,从而导致次优的用户体验。

Didit 深刻理解这一挑战。我们的人工智能原生、开发者优先的身份平台以性能和效率为核心。无论您是实施身份验证、被动和主动活体检测,还是 1:1 人脸匹配,我们的 SDK 都经过精心设计,以确保它们在增强应用程序功能的同时不影响其性能。我们优先以最轻量级和最有效的方式提供强大的安全和验证功能,让您的用户能够快速无缝地完成身份检查。

最小化 SDK 包大小的策略

最小化任何 SDK 的包大小都是一项复杂的任务,需要仔细的设计和开发选择。对于身份验证 SDK,由于需要包含各种高级功能,如用于身份验证的 OCR、复杂的活体检测算法和生物识别匹配,这一挑战被放大了。Didit 采用几种关键策略来保持我们的 SDK 精简:

  • 模块化设计:我们的架构本质上是模块化的。这意味着您只集成您需要的特定组件。例如,如果您只需要身份验证,您就不会被迫包含 AML 筛选或年龄估算的代码。这种“即插即用”的方法显著减小了初始包大小。
  • 高效资源管理:我们优化所有资产,包括图像、字体和其他媒体,使其在不影响质量的前提下尽可能小。这包括在适当情况下使用优化的图像格式和矢量图形。
  • 代码优化和摇树优化:我们的工程师精心编写干净、高效的代码,并利用支持摇树优化的现代构建工具。此过程会自动从最终包中删除未使用的代码,确保只包含您的应用程序实际调用的代码。
  • 动态加载:对于某些较大的组件或不常用的功能,我们实施动态加载,允许它们在实际需要时才下载,而不是作为初始应用包的一部分。

这些策略共同确保 Didit 的 SDK 提供强大的身份验证功能,同时在您的应用程序中保持最小的占用空间。

加速加载时间以实现无缝用户体验

除了包大小,加载时间也是用户满意度的关键因素。一个大的包当然会导致加载时间缓慢,但其他因素也起着重要作用。Didit 的 SDK 通过以下方式优化速度:

  • 优化初始化:我们的 SDK 旨在快速初始化,高效地执行必要的设置任务,而不会阻塞主 UI 线程。
  • 异步操作:所有网络请求和计算密集型任务,例如处理用于被动和主动活体检测的图像或执行 1:1 人脸匹配,都以异步方式处理。这可以防止应用程序在验证步骤中冻结或无响应。
  • 边缘计算和 CDN 使用:Didit 利用全球边缘服务器网络和内容分发网络(CDN)来确保后端 API 调用和资源交付尽可能快,无论用户的地理位置如何。
  • 智能数据压缩:SDK 和 Didit 后端之间传输的数据被有效地压缩,以最大限度地减少传输时间,这在网络连接较慢的地区尤其有利。

通过关注这些领域,Didit 确保整个身份验证过程,从文档捕获到活体检测,都非常快速,从而带来流畅积极的用户体验。

Didit 优势:性能、安全性和灵活性

Didit 通过提供全面的身份验证解决方案而脱颖而出,该解决方案无需您在性能和强大安全性之间做出选择。我们对人工智能原生方法的承诺意味着我们的身份验证、被动和主动活体检测以及 1:1 人脸匹配算法不仅高度准确,而且效率极高。这种效率直接转化为更小的 SDK 和更快的处理时间。

我们的模块化架构是我们开发者优先理念的基石,使您能够精确选择所需的身份原语。无论是用于年龄限制内容的身份验证、年龄估算,还是用于合规性的 AML 筛选和监控,您都可以独立集成这些组件。这大大减少了应用程序中不必要的代码量,直接影响包大小和加载时间。此外,Didit 提供免费核心 KYC,使各种规模的企业都能实现基本的身份验证,而无需初始财务障碍,同时受益于我们优化的 SDK。

Didit 如何提供帮助

Didit 为将身份验证集成到您的移动应用程序中提供了强大而轻量级的解决方案。我们的 SDK 从头开始构建为人工智能原生,确保像身份验证(带 OCR、MRZ 和条形码扫描)、被动和主动活体检测以及 1:1 人脸匹配等高级功能以无与伦比的效率提供。模块化架构意味着您只部署您需要的功能,最大限度地减少应用程序的占用空间并最大化性能。我们提供免费核心 KYC,使企业级身份验证对所有人开放,无需设置费用。通过选择 Didit,您将获得一个致力于为您的用户提供无缝、安全和闪电般快速的身份验证体验的合作伙伴,而不会影响您应用程序的性能或您的开发预算。

准备好开始了吗?

准备好亲身体验 Didit 了吗?立即获取免费演示

使用Didit 的免费套餐免费开始验证身份。

身份与欺诈基础设施。

一个 API 即可实现 KYC、KYB、交易监控和钱包筛选。5 分钟即可集成。

让 AI 总结此页面
Didit SDK:优化移动应用包大小与加载时间.